About the Role
We are seeking a highly motivated student to join our engineering team as a Part-Time RF Measurement Engineer. This position provides an opportunity to gain hands-on experience with state-of-the-art RF measurement equipment, semiconductor technologies, and advanced packaging solutions while continuing graduate studies.
The successful candidate will support RF characterization, measurement automation, and data analysis activities for next-generation wireless and semiconductor products including auto radar and wireless communications.
Key Responsibilities
- Conduct RF and microwave measurements on various semiconductor devices, packages, and test structures.
- Operate and maintain laboratory equipment
- Perform RF characterization
- Support development of automated measurement solutions using Python, MATLAB, or LabVIEW.
- Analyze measurement results and generate technical reports.
- Collaborate with design, packaging, and product engineering teams to troubleshoot RF performance issues.
- Assist in developing and documenting RF test methodologies and best practices.
Your Profile
- Currently enrolled in a Master's or Ph.D. program in Electrical Engineerin, Electrical and Computer Engineering, Physics, Applied Physic or other related engineering discipline
- Coursework or research experience in one or more of the following: RF Engineering, Microwave Engineering, Electromagnetics, Wireless Communications, Signal Integrity
- Basic understanding of S-parameters, Transmission lines,Smith Charts, Network Analysis
